About Ward XVI

In 2017 the first chapter of a planned trilogy of concept albums, ‘The Art of Manipulation’, introduced you to the sordid story of Psychoberrie- the UK’s most notorious serial killer now incarcerated among the warped inhabitants of Ward XVI.
The album was greeted with critical acclaim with catchy female vocals, hard-hitting metal riffs, off-beat ska rhythms, melancholic piano, jaunty accordions, and a hint of electro. Each member drew from their own eclectic influences that included Alice Cooper, Iron Maiden, Rob Zombie, Diablo Swing Orchestra, Alter Bridge and Avatar.

Genres:
Metal, Theatrical Avant-garde Rock, Hard Rock, Female Fronted
Band Members:
Bam Bam Bedlam - Drums, Wolfy Huntsman - Bass/Vocals, Psychoberrie - Lead Vocals, Dr. Von Stottenstein - Guitars
Hometown:
Manchester, United Kingdom
